Shoe Colors That Pair Beautifully with a Gold Dress
The color of your shoes is perhaps the most critical factor in achieving a harmonious look. Several colors effortlessly complement a gold dress, creating a visually stunning effect. Consider these options when selecting your footwear.
Classic Neutrals: Black, Nude, and White
Black shoes offer a timeless and sophisticated contrast to gold. They ground the look, adding a touch of boldness and edge. Nude shoes, on the other hand, create a seamless, leg-lengthening effect, allowing the gold dress to take center stage. White shoes, while less common, can offer a fresh and modern aesthetic, especially with a more casual or contemporary gold dress.
Metallic Magic: Gold and Silver
Pairing a gold dress with gold or silver shoes is a surefire way to amplify the glamour. Matching gold shoes create a monochromatic effect, ideal for a formal event. Silver shoes introduce a cool contrast that can be particularly striking. Be mindful of the shade of gold in your dress; warmer golds pair well with gold shoes, while cooler golds often look fantastic with silver.
Bold and Beautiful: Jewel Tones
For a more daring look, consider jewel-toned shoes. Emerald green, sapphire blue, and ruby red can add a pop of color and personality to your outfit. These vibrant shades create a striking contrast against the gold, making a bold fashion statement. Ensure the jewel tone complements the undertones of your gold dress to avoid clashing. Earthy Elegance: Brown and Bronze
Brown and bronze shoes offer a warm and earthy alternative, particularly suitable for daytime events or a more relaxed vibe. These colors provide a subtle complement to the gold, creating a sophisticated and understated look. Choose shades that complement the undertones of your gold dress for a cohesive appearance.
Shoe Styles That Complement a Gold Dress
Beyond color, the style of your shoes plays a significant role in the overall aesthetic. The occasion, the length of your dress, and your personal style will influence your choice. Here are some popular shoe styles that work well with a gold dress.
Heels: Pumps, Stilettos, and Block Heels
Pumps are a classic choice, offering elegance and versatility. Stilettos are perfect for formal events, adding height and a touch of drama. Block heels provide comfort and stability while still maintaining a stylish appearance. Heels elongate the legs and add a touch of sophistication, making them a go-to choice for many gold dress outfits.
Strappy Sandals: Delicate and Daring
Strappy sandals, especially those with delicate straps, offer a chic and modern look. They are ideal for warmer weather and formal occasions. Choose strappy sandals in neutral colors or metallic shades to complement the gold dress. The minimalist design of strappy sandals allows the dress to shine.
Flats: Comfort and Style
For comfort and practicality, flats are an excellent option. Ballet flats or pointed-toe flats can provide a stylish alternative to heels. Flats are particularly suitable for daytime events or when you anticipate a lot of walking. Look for flats in metallic shades or neutral colors to maintain a polished look.
Boots: An Unexpected Edge
Ankle boots or knee-high boots can add an unexpected edge to a gold dress. This combination works well for cooler weather or a more fashion-forward look. Choose boots in black, brown, or a metallic shade that complements the gold. Ensure the style of the boots aligns with the overall aesthetic of your outfit.

Formal Events: Weddings and Galas
For formal events such as weddings and galas, opt for elegant heels like pumps or stilettos. Metallic shoes, such as gold or silver, are a perfect choice to amplify the glamour. Ensure the shoes complement the dress’s embellishments and overall style.
Semi-Formal Events: Cocktail Parties and Dinner Dates
For semi-formal events, you have more flexibility. Strappy sandals, block heels, or even dressy flats can work well. Consider the venue and the dress code. Nude or jewel-toned shoes can add a touch of personality to your outfit.
Casual Events: Day Parties and Brunches
For casual events, comfort is key. Flats or low-heeled sandals are excellent choices. Metallic or neutral-colored flats can provide a stylish yet comfortable option. Consider the weather and the venue when making your selection.
Dress Length and Silhouette
The length and silhouette of your gold dress will influence your shoe choice. Consider these guidelines:
- Floor-length gowns: Heels are generally recommended to prevent the dress from dragging on the ground.
- Midi dresses: Heels, strappy sandals, or even stylish flats can work well.
- Mini dresses: Heels or ankle boots can elongate the legs and create a balanced look.
- A-line dresses: Versatile; can be paired with various shoe styles.
- Bodycon dresses: Heels or strappy sandals are often preferred to create a streamlined silhouette.

Pro Tips for Choosing Shoes with a Gold Dress
Consider the Undertones: Pay attention to the undertones of your gold dress (warm or cool) when selecting shoe colors. This will help you create a more harmonious look.
Comfort is Key: Choose shoes that you can comfortably wear for the duration of the event.
Test the Look: Try on the entire outfit, including shoes, accessories, and jewelry, before the event to ensure everything works well together.

What Are the Most Versatile Shoe Colors to Wear with a Gold Dress?
The most versatile shoe colors are black, nude, and gold. Black shoes provide a classic contrast, nude shoes create a seamless look, and gold shoes enhance the dress’s inherent glamour. These colors can be paired with various styles of gold dresses and are suitable for many occasions.
Can I Wear Silver Shoes with a Gold Dress?
Yes, silver shoes can look fantastic with a gold dress. Silver provides a cool contrast to the warm tones of gold, creating a chic and modern aesthetic. Consider the shade of gold in your dress. If your dress has cooler gold tones, silver shoes can be a particularly great choice.
What Type of Shoes Should I Avoid Wearing with a Gold Dress?
Avoid shoes that clash with the gold dress or detract from its elegance. Avoid overly casual shoes like sneakers (unless the dress is specifically designed for a casual look), and shoes with excessive embellishments that compete with the dress. Also, avoid shoes in colors that clash with the undertones of the gold dress.
